Transaction 20826d65beee90b83ff8b0850b1f257b8d28d8ac934813fc56294db14e3b96b7
2 Input
2 Outputs
- 20826d65beee90b83ff8b0850b1f257b8d28d8ac934813fc56294db14e3b96b7:0
- 20826d65beee90b83ff8b0850b1f257b8d28d8ac934813fc56294db14e3b96b7:1
value 95158234
address 3QQKRwuVyRgv7xZVN9aR1z8p7SUFukAsCz
value 2000000
address 12QyvheqEACwx4hADyCXRoqoWcMndPzWLs